pjece

Danish

Etymology

From French pièce, from Late Latin pettia (piece), from Gaulish *pettyā, from Proto-Celtic *kʷezdis, cognate with Welsh peth (thing) and Irish cuid (part).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): [ˈpʰj̊ɛːsə]

Noun

pjece c (singular definite pjecen, plural indefinite pjecer)

  1. booklet, pamphlet, leaflet
  2. (military) piece, gun
